X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/a7adaedae8ff61356e895c7ddb1a03bd176dcf6c..aa154cb1578ba9d44c7e24c5e76d8238bf8809d0:/utils/HelpGen/src/sourcepainter.cpp diff --git a/utils/HelpGen/src/sourcepainter.cpp b/utils/HelpGen/src/sourcepainter.cpp index 6814b5ffee..0c58ea5452 100644 --- a/utils/HelpGen/src/sourcepainter.cpp +++ b/utils/HelpGen/src/sourcepainter.cpp @@ -21,12 +21,9 @@ #endif #if defined( wxUSE_TEMPLATE_STL ) - - #include +# include #else - - #include "wxstlac.h" - +# include "wxstlac.h" #endif #include "sourcepainter.h" @@ -642,20 +639,20 @@ void SourcePainter::GetResultString(string& result, MarkupTagsT tags) // ASSERT( mCollectResultsOn ); result = ""; - int pos = 0; + unsigned pos = 0; for( size_t i = 0; i != mBlocks.size(); ++i ) { int desc = mBlocks[i]; - int len = desc & 0xFFFF; + unsigned len = desc & 0xFFFF; int rank = (desc >> 16) & 0xFFFF; result += tags[ rank_tags_map[rank] ].start; - for( int n = 0; n != len; ++n ) + for( unsigned n = 0; n != len; ++n ) - result += mResultStr[pos+n]; + result += mResultStr[(unsigned int)(pos+n)]; pos += len;